Como ler um arquivo

2 respostas
F

Eai galera,

Eu gostaria de saber como ler um arquivo(que não e de texto)com um programa em java e depois poder armazenar um dado do arquivo em uma string
:arrow:
valeu :!:

2 Respostas

V

Se é o que eu entendi você deverá usar o método read() do objeto [color=“red”]FileInputStream[/color] e passar para uma variável do tipo [color=“blue”]byte[/color] e então fazer a conversão para adicionar em um objeto do tipo [color=“red”]StringBuffer[/color].

M

Bom, se você quer string mesmo, acho que o mais interessante é ler o objeto de dentro do arquivo e aí você converte cada atributo do objeto para string. Seria bem mais proveitoso…
Dê uma procurada em readObject e writeObject das classes ObjectInput e ObjectOutput respectivamente.
Se não me engano, declarando que sua classe implementa a interface serializable, você já pode usar esses métodos… Tem que checar na API…

Att

Criado 18 de agosto de 2004
Ultima resposta 18 de ago. de 2004
Respostas 2
Participantes 3